Our platform helps users follow stock markets through earnings insights, technical analysis, and financial news coverage. NeOnc Technologies Holdings Inc. (NTHI) reported a first-quarter 2026 net loss of $0.35 per share, significantly wider than the consensus estimate of a $0.2244 loss, representing a negative surprise of 55.97%. The company reported no revenue for the period, consistent with its pre-revenue development stage. Following the earnings release, NTHI shares declined 1.11%, reflecting investor disappointment with the deeper-than-anticipated operating loss.

Management attributed the wider loss primarily to increased research and development expenses tied to the ongoing clinical development of the company’s lead oncology candidates. During the quarter, NeOnc continued to advance its therapeutic pipeline, with key activities focused on patient enrollment in early-stage trials for its novel drug delivery platform. Operating expenses rose as the company scaled up manufacturing and regulatory activities. As a pre-revenue biotechnology firm, NeOnc does not report segment revenue or gross margin; instead, its financial performance is measured by the rate of cash consumption and progress toward clinical milestones. The reported net loss of $0.35 per share reflects the cash-intensive nature of drug development, with no offsetting product sales. Management did not provide specific details on individual program spending but emphasized that resources are being allocated efficiently to maintain trial momentum.

Looking ahead, NeOnc may provide updated guidance on its clinical timelines and cash runway during the upcoming earnings call. Given the absence of approved products, the company’s near-term outlook centers on achieving key regulatory and clinical milestones rather than financial targets. Management expects continued investment in research and development as it pursues potential registration-enabling studies for its lead asset. Strategic priorities for 2026 include advancing pipeline candidates through proof-of-concept trials and exploring partnership opportunities to extend the company’s cash runway. Risks to the outlook include potential delays in patient enrollment, regulatory hurdles, and the need for additional financing. The company may seek dilutive or non-dilutive capital to fund operations, as no revenue is anticipated in the near term.

The stock’s 1.11% decline following the earnings report suggests that the wider-than-expected loss weighed on investor sentiment, though the move was relatively modest compared to the magnitude of the earnings miss. Analysts may view the quarter’s results as a reflection of the inherently higher-risk profile of pre-revenue biotech companies, where progress on clinical data is often more impactful than short-term financial results. Investment implications for NTHI hinge on upcoming data readouts and the company’s ability to manage its cash burn rate. Investors will likely monitor the cash position and any updates on the pipeline’s advancement. The lack of revenue and the deeper loss could increase scrutiny on the company’s funding strategy. What to watch next includes any announcements regarding trial enrollment updates or potential collaborations that might alter the financial trajectory.
